Some more timing information needed Shadi. If you flip it from reverse to drive and plant your foot then it will take a moment for the gears to change and power to be applied. Separate out the actions - is it slow to change from reverse into forwards or, if you engage drive from neutral, wait a moment and then plant your foot, is it slow to respond to the accelerator? *
